Fortnite
Fortnite is a shareware action game with elements of survival in a colorful post-apocalyptic world. Most of the planet was destroyed by a cataclysm, due to which strange zombie-like creatures began to appear. The survivors called them Husks. The last representatives of mankind fight off them, hiding in bizarre shelters, assembled from various materials. Along the way, they try to figure out the causes of the strange purple storm that started it all.

Fortnite Chapter 4 Season 2 Start Date and Server Downtime

Epic Games has confirmed that the second season of Fortnite Chapter 4 titled MEGA will begin on Friday, March 10, 2023.

The developers have also announced that the downtime before the update is complete will start at 10:00 Moscow time, 2:00 AM ET, 23:00 PM PT, 7:00 AM GMT March 10., and is expected to last one to two hours.

During this time, the servers will be down and you won't be able to access Fortnite until the new season starts.


Fortnite first person mode

While the developers have yet to officially reveal what's coming in the Fortnite v24.00 update, leaks have shown that the long-awaited first-person mode could be coming. It's unclear if this will be an LTM or a long-term expansion, but fans will be eager to experience Fortnite in a completely different way.

Rumors of a first-person mode first surfaced back in 2020 when HYPEX stated that the feature was in development. Then a glitch at the start of Chapter 4 seemed to show what that mode might look like.

Now, if the leaks are to be believed, it seems the wait is finally over, with Fortnite first-person coming to Chapter 4 Season XNUMX.


Secret” skin - Eren Yeager from Attack on Titan in Fortnite

Fortnite is well known for its crossovers, and it looks like the groundbreaking Attack on Titan anime will be a major collaboration in season two. After the inclusion of Geralt last season, HYPEX and Shiina stated that AoT's Eren Yeager would be a secret skin in the new battle pass.

Players can also look forward to a host of Attack on Titan-themed cosmetic items to accompany Eren, including an emote, emoji, pickaxe, weapon wrap, and other pages yet to be revealed.

The AoT crossover fits in nicely with this season's theme, which seems to draw inspiration from Japanese culture in many of its skins and locations.

Wall running in fortnite

Dataminers also often find information about a new mechanic - wall running.

This feature will work like this:

  • To run on a wall, start running on the floor, then press "Jump" next to the wall.
  • The distance you run on the wall depends on your speed.
  • The distance you jump after wall running also depends on your speed.
